Commit Graph

177 Commits

Author SHA1 Message Date
sairaj mote
4a1c3de62a UI changes and code refactoring 2022-10-18 03:04:27 +05:30
sairaj mote
3dcb8b0e5a Merging intern and task application processes 2022-10-18 02:46:57 +05:30
sairaj mote
0c0fd6bc31 added option assign multiple interns at once 2022-10-16 22:11:55 +05:30
sairaj mote
1a9bfd24b1 clear stored task ID to apply for application 2022-10-16 04:39:32 +05:30
sairaj mote
cf5086450f Feature update
-- added option to apply for a task directly from landing page
2022-10-16 04:36:47 +05:30
sairaj mote
ab3609d17f code refactoring 2022-10-15 18:15:42 +05:30
sairaj mote
219ae08ad1 code refactoring 2022-10-15 00:52:32 +05:30
sairaj mote
510aac1d59 code refactoring 2022-10-14 23:21:30 +05:30
sairajzero
3b092a6565 Update adminID 2022-10-14 22:27:33 +05:30
sairaj mote
14e49f6527 Bug fixes and feature update 2022-10-14 22:18:35 +05:30
sairaj mote
73b23101a4 UI/UX and functionality changes
-- moving object data fetching to mid startup
-- adding more fields to task creation
-- code refactoring
2022-10-10 19:12:36 +05:30
sairaj mote
e7e58628d8 UI improvements 2022-10-06 19:52:36 +05:30
sairaj mote
055c40a281 Code refactoring and UI improvements 2022-10-05 18:48:32 +05:30
sairaj mote
87d7a14e32 Adding one more section to landing page 2022-10-04 18:30:14 +05:30
sairaj mote
66484e972e adding landing page illustration 2022-10-04 17:52:29 +05:30
sairaj mote
19b560a15f UI improvements 2022-10-04 17:18:31 +05:30
sairaj mote
562bb8afcc Added password visibility toggle 2022-10-04 16:36:32 +05:30
sairaj mote
35efa8e1e8 Project pinning UI/UX improvements 2022-10-04 00:51:37 +05:30
sairaj mote
8217823752 Feature update
-- Added option to download FLO credentials as txt file
2022-10-03 02:29:52 +05:30
sairaj mote
f1f8b4e88e Code refactoring and bug fixes 2022-09-27 03:39:45 +05:30
sairaj mote
a4f3d2250e UI improvements 2022-09-23 17:41:29 +05:30
sairaj mote
9b2a9cab5f minor UI improvements 2022-09-23 03:24:09 +05:30
sairaj mote
9d0252f0b2 Bug fixes 2022-09-23 03:09:10 +05:30
sairaj mote
c8c8356b1c code refactoring 2022-09-23 02:54:04 +05:30
sairaj mote
f5bfbb0494 bug fixes 2022-09-17 00:59:16 +05:30
sairaj mote
83ad0aa349 minor code refactoring 2022-09-15 16:44:43 +05:30
sairaj mote
1a2824fd0c bug fixes 2022-09-14 23:00:34 +05:30
sairaj mote
d2a24d3787 minor tweak 2022-09-14 18:31:54 +05:30
sairaj mote
c3424d1801 Feature update, UI/UX improvements and bug fixes
-- added option to send link related to work in internship application and intern updates
-- added option to view project specific updates when views project details
-- when assigning interns only un-assigned interns will show up in intern selection popup
-- filtering updates now has proper routing
2022-09-14 18:30:19 +05:30
sairaj mote
ac730efaec minor bug fix 2022-09-13 04:19:29 +05:30
sairaj mote
10a87a0058 added UI for viewing intern request status 2022-09-13 03:59:34 +05:30
sairaj mote
6af16888e6 Added UI for replying to intern updates 2022-09-12 18:34:45 +05:30
sairaj mote
fccc29a8ba Feature, UI update and bug fixes
-- added option to apply for internship
-- code refactoring and optimizations
2022-09-11 02:37:08 +05:30
sairaj mote
6c08034f4b UI improvements and bug fixes 2022-09-10 02:47:42 +05:30
sairajzero
95a279fc44 Minor fix
getTaskRequests and getInternRequests moved to RIBC (ie, not inside admin now)
2022-09-08 18:11:58 +05:30
sairaj mote
a069e1f79d Bug fixes 2022-09-08 17:55:28 +05:30
sairaj mote
0dcea80845 Code refactoring and bug fixes
-- added UI for editing project title and description
-- fixed bug related to not able to remove assigned intern
2022-09-08 03:01:44 +05:30
sairajzero
d119d40432 Move to new cloud 2022-09-04 04:04:39 +05:30
sairajzero
fa3d790c6c floDapps v2.3.2: lock privkey by default
- Removed the options for launchStartUp
- private-key is on lock mode by default
- Added utility functions that uses private-key without entering password in .user
  .sign(message): signs message
  .decrypt(data): decrypts ciphertext in asymmetric
  .encipher(message): encrypts message in symmetric
  .decipher(data): decrypts ciphertext in symmetric
2022-07-24 02:29:04 +05:30
sairajzero
b80bd43313 floDapps, floCloudAPI: Secure private key
- Store AES-encrypted private key in memory. (exploring memory of browser will not have raw private key)
- floDapps lock/unlock (in user): locks or unlock the private key (ie, lock= Password required, unlock= password not required in returning private key)
- floDapps.launchStartUp now accepts options object
- to lock the private key on startup, pass {lock_key: true} in options objects of launchStartUp
2022-07-17 17:02:27 +05:30
sairajzero
cfc36b80cd Secure private key using capsule 2022-07-16 03:30:03 +05:30
sairajzero
5d7d3bdb53 floBlockchainAPI v2.3.2a
sendTx:
- check total balance before processing utxos
- reject "Insufficient FLO: Some UTXOs are unconfirmed" when balance is there but some utxo are used/unconfimed
2022-05-21 22:19:54 +05:30
sairajzero
8603cde17e Moving all defaults/containers to resp. modules
- Removed default values from floGlobals
- Default values are now in their respective modules
- The following properties of floGlobals can be use to override the default values of respective modules: apiURL, sendAmt, fee, tokenURL, currency, SNStorageID
- Default/current values can be obtained from each module with getter properties
- Some current values can be set with setter properties
- The containers for appObjects, generalData, lastVC are now in floCloudAPI module. Also automatically adds get/set properties for them in floGlobals. Thus can be accessed from floGlobals as before
2022-05-16 21:20:21 +05:30
sairajzero
99368151d5 Adding floTokenAPI
- Token Operator to send/receive tokens via blockchain using token system API

floBlockchainAPI v2.3.1
- Added options parameter to writeData . Options can have the following properties:
 . strict_utxo : passes strict_utxo parameter to sendTx (Default: true)
 . sendAmt : amount of FLO to send (Default: floGlobals.sendAmt)
2022-05-16 18:46:22 +05:30
sairajzero
f27c8c4f03 Bug fixes
- Renamed standard_Operations.html to index.html
- Fixed some minor bugs in floCloudAPI
- Added: floCrypto.validateFloID (alias for floCrypto.validateAddr)
2022-03-31 21:54:51 +05:30
sairaj mote
808a7240ab Fixing optional chaining issue on Brave 2022-01-03 16:26:39 +05:30
sairaj mote
e79d7d117c logout bug fix 2021-08-22 16:29:34 +05:30
sairaj mote
6ccbc141d4 Deploying new version of RIBC 2021-08-04 15:10:20 +05:30
SaketAnand
0da97e96d1 Merge branch 'master' of https://github.com/ranchimall/RIBC 2021-06-12 13:54:05 +05:30
SaketAnand
d95cf20b8b Update index.html
added backslash to flosight api
2021-06-12 13:53:28 +05:30
Ritika-Agrawal0811
8b3836a827 bug fix 2021-06-08 10:44:10 +05:30
SaketAnand
06e1cc7c13 Update index.html
updated apiurl for flosight
2021-06-06 15:41:25 +05:30
Sai Raj
45eb340844
updating apiurl 2021-06-05 13:32:20 +05:30
Sai Raj
ed4243f70c
bugfix: flosight 2021-06-05 13:26:14 +05:30
Sai Raj
577743e0e4
bugfix: flosight 2021-06-05 13:18:11 +05:30
Vivek Teega
a83b8336b5 Updating flosight list 2020-12-02 12:06:27 +05:30
sairaj mote
3b5bca79f9
fixed bug with intern assignment 2020-06-18 12:34:47 +05:30
Sai Raj
b26fb83057
Renamed applications to request 2020-06-11 02:46:26 +05:30
Sai Raj
f6481b5868
Improvement for applications (backend script)
- Improved generalData fetch (ie, non subAdmin users will not request generalData that are required only by subAdmins).
- Moved getTaskApplication to manage (as it is a subAdmin-only feature).
- Added applyForIntern feature to allow non-intern users to apply as intern.
- Added application status feature to allow subAdmins to coordinate among the applications. (setApplicationStatus and getApplicationStatus).
- Added getInternApplications to view the intern applications
- Improved getInternApplications and getTaskApplications to filter out processed (i.e, applications that have status set)
- Renamed putTaskDetails to editTaskDetails
2020-06-11 02:37:58 +05:30
Sai Raj
605a631b16
bug fix: SignIn button not enabled on copy paste 2020-06-08 11:08:31 +05:30
Vivek Teega
90a66410b7
renaming to index.html 2020-04-17 15:01:35 +05:30
Sai Raj
5ae3214a67
Rename index.html to standard_Operations.html 2019-11-20 18:15:34 +05:30
sairajzero
ce28df6834 adding automatic fetch for flosight API 2019-11-20 02:07:35 +05:30
sairajzero
289089d972 Adding floCloudAPI
floCloudAPI has methods to send application data, request application data, reset or update object data.
2019-11-19 20:11:32 +05:30
sairajzero
d79d54b400 Updating to match the backup node feature of SN 2019-11-19 20:09:15 +05:30
Sai Raj
57d16248d9
fixing bug in initDB 2019-10-17 17:21:07 +05:30
Sai Raj
049cd5823c
changing ws:// to wss:// in supernode module 2019-10-17 15:55:24 +05:30
Sai Raj
b1c6d8c153
fixing broadcastTx not been asynchronized call 2019-10-13 03:04:28 +05:30
sairajzero
ed59eeeb65 Added removeData in compactIDB 2019-10-06 03:51:13 +05:30
sairajzero
68472cad56 floBlockchainAPI.readData will now return a object with totalTxs and data 2019-10-06 03:15:18 +05:30
sairajzero
9da3168f45 Improved Read Data from blockchain via API
Replaced floBlockchainAPI's readSentData, readDataPattern, readSentDataPattern, readDataContains, readSentDataContains with a improved version 'readData'
readData is Promisfied function that reads and resolves floData from blockchain using API
Arguments :
addr - address from which the floData should be read
options - (optional object, default = {})
Options :
limit - maximum number of filtered data (default = 1000, negative  = no limit)
ignoreOld - ignore old txs (default = 0)
sentOnly - filters only sent data
pattern - filters data that starts with a pattern
contains - filters data that contains a string
filter - custom filter funtion for floData (eg . filter: d => {return d[0] == '$'})
2019-10-06 02:52:34 +05:30
sairajzero
8fd579dc5e Removed supernode Server
Removed supernode server so that this repo can be templated directly for projects
2019-10-04 21:16:55 +05:30
sairajzero
ae71390df4 fixing bugs 2019-10-04 20:35:10 +05:30
sairajzero
9bdac8b042 fixing some bugs 2019-10-04 20:34:26 +05:30
sairajzero
2ea373ef2d improved reading floData via API 2019-10-04 20:31:56 +05:30
sairajzero
bd52c44169 Added compactIDB operations and fixed bugs 2019-09-29 13:55:46 +05:30
sairajzero
dd402cd454 Adding files 2019-09-27 21:34:16 +05:30